DBCheckBox
Caros colegas,
Tô desenvolvendo uma aplicação com Delphi 7 e Firebird 1.5 e tô com o seguinte problema: Como o Firebird 1.5 não tem campo boolean, eu criei um domínio, e no delphi coloquei o dbcheckbox lincado a esse campo. O problema é q sempre q abro o formulário, o dbcheckbox fica como se estivesse desabilitado o seu enable, e é necessário clicar nele p/ele ficar normal, e no caso ele sempre fica marcado como se a propriedade no banco estive True. Como resolver isso?
Desde já agradeço.
[ ]´s
Tô desenvolvendo uma aplicação com Delphi 7 e Firebird 1.5 e tô com o seguinte problema: Como o Firebird 1.5 não tem campo boolean, eu criei um domínio, e no delphi coloquei o dbcheckbox lincado a esse campo. O problema é q sempre q abro o formulário, o dbcheckbox fica como se estivesse desabilitado o seu enable, e é necessário clicar nele p/ele ficar normal, e no caso ele sempre fica marcado como se a propriedade no banco estive True. Como resolver isso?
Desde já agradeço.
[ ]´s
Fabiano_aprendiz
Curtidas 0
Respostas
Paullsoftware
16/03/2007
Configure o campo para o tipo VarChar com tamanho de 1 e no delphi selecione o componente dbchecked ele possui as propriedades ValueUnChecked e ValueChecked onde vc pode colocar S para sim(true) e N para nao(false)...
pronto!
agora quando o campo estiver selecionado armazenará ´S´ e quando não ficará ´N´...
espero ter ajudado :wink:
pronto!
agora quando o campo estiver selecionado armazenará ´S´ e quando não ficará ´N´...
espero ter ajudado :wink:
GOSTEI 0